Q: Is 164,150,611 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 164,150,611 is a composite number.

Why is 164,150,611 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 164,150,611 can be evenly divided by 1 31 37 1,147 143,113 4,436,503 5,295,181 and 164,150,611, with no remainder.

Since 164,150,611 cannot be divided by just 1 and 164,150,611, it is a composite number.
